CAL: T/E Indicator

The CAL: T/E indicator shows changes to temperature (T) or exposure (E) in relation to the active calibration map. If the temperature or exposure change significantly, calibrate the sensor at the desired temperature and exposure. Failure to properly calibrate the sensor may reduce image quality.

  • Green: Sensor temperature or exposure are properly calibrated for current settings.
  • Yellow: Slight change in sensor temperature or exposure.
  • Red: Significant change in sensor temperature or exposure.
  • The – and + indicate whether the sensor temperature or exposure has decreased or increased, respectively.

NOTE: T and E indicators change colors independently of each other.
